React启动概述
React是一种用于构建用户界面的JavaScript库。React应用程序的启动过程包括安装和配置必要的工具,创建项目结构,引入React依赖项以及运行开发服务器。本文将详细介绍React启动的步骤和相关内容。
安装Node.js和npm
在开始React应用程序的启动之前,首先需要安装Node.js和npm。Node.js是一个用于在服务器上运行JavaScript代码的运行时环境,而npm是Node.js的软件包管理器。
可以通过在终端或命令提示符中运行以下命令来检查是否已成功安装Node.js和npm:
$ node -v
$ npm -v
创建React应用程序
一旦安装了Node.js和npm,就可以使用Create React App工具快速创建一个新的React应用程序。Create React App是一个官方支持的用于创建React项目的命令行工具。
可以通过以下命令在命令提示符或终端中创建一个新的React应用程序:
$ npx create-react-app my-app
$ cd my-app
启动开发服务器
在成功创建React应用程序之后,进入项目目录并运行以下命令来启动开发服务器:
$ npm start
这将启动一个本地开发服务器,并在浏览器中打开应用程序以进行开发和调试。在开发过程中,任何对代码的更改都会自动重新加载,并且在浏览器中实时预览。
编写React组件
在React应用程序中,界面被划分为可重用的组件,每个组件具有自己的状态和属性。编写React组件是构建React应用程序的关键部分。
可以使用任何文本编辑器或集成开发环境(IDE)来编辑React组件。在项目结构中找到src目录,并编辑App.js文件以开始编写组件。
构建和部署
一旦完成React应用程序的开发,可以使用以下命令构建生产版本:
$ npm run build
这将在项目结构中生成一个build目录,其中包含优化过的、可用于部署的静态文件。可以将这些文件上传到任何静态文件服务器上以部署React应用程序。
总结
本文为您提供了有关React启动的详细内容。首先,您需要安装Node.js和npm。然后,使用Create React App工具创建React应用程序,并启动开发服务器以进行开发和调试。在编写React组件并完成开发后,可以构建生产版本并部署应用程序。
希望本文对您理解React启动过程有所帮助。如果您对React还有其他疑问,请查阅React官方文档以获取更多信息。